Summary:
The 14031 zip code in New York is home to a single standout middle school, Clarence Middle School, which serves grades 6-8 and is part of the Clarence Central School District. This exceptional institution consistently ranks among the top 13% of middle schools in the state, earning a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ger and boasting impressive proficiency rates on state assessments that far exceed the statewide averages.
Clarence Middle School's academic excellence is evident across multiple subjects and grade levels. In the 2024-2025 school year, 76.19% of 6th graders were proficient or better in ELA, compared to the state average of 50.86%. The school also excels in Regents exams, with 100% proficiency rates in Earth Science and Algebra I, significantly outperforming the state. Additionally, the school's relatively low percentage of students receiving free or reduced-price lunch (19.29% in 2023-2024) suggests a more affluent student population, which may contribute to the school's strong academic performance.
With a student-teacher ratio of 10.3 to 1 and per-student spending of $20,442 (2023-2024), Clarence Middle School appears to be well-resourced, enabling it to provide a high-quality educational experience for its students.
